protobuf/benchmarks/util
Joshua Haberman c649397029
Set execute bit on files if and only if they begin with (#!). (#7347)
* Set execute bit on files if and only if they begin with (#!).

Git only tracks the 'x' (executable) bit on each file. Prior to this
CL, our files were a random mix of executable and non-executable.
This change imposes some order by making files executable if and only
if they have shebang (#!) lines at the beginning.

We don't have any executable binaries checked into the repo, so
we shouldn't need to worry about that case.

* Added fix_permissions.sh script to set +x iff a file begins with (#!).
2020-04-01 15:28:25 -07:00
..
__init__.py Add script for run and upload the benchmark result to bq 2018-04-10 13:26:17 -07:00
big_query_utils.py print() is a function in Python 3 (#4754) 2018-06-20 15:18:20 -07:00
data_proto2_to_proto3_util.h Fix 2018-06-04 10:16:40 -07:00
gogo_data_scrubber.cc Add proto2 to proto3 util 2018-05-30 17:06:45 -07:00
proto3_data_stripper.cc Add proto2 to proto3 util 2018-05-30 17:06:45 -07:00
protoc-gen-gogoproto.cc Add proto2 to proto3 util 2018-05-30 17:06:45 -07:00
protoc-gen-proto2_to_proto3.cc Fix 2018-06-04 10:16:40 -07:00
result_parser.py Set execute bit on files if and only if they begin with (#!). (#7347) 2020-04-01 15:28:25 -07:00
result_uploader.py Set execute bit on files if and only if they begin with (#!). (#7347) 2020-04-01 15:28:25 -07:00
schema_proto2_to_proto3_util.h Fix 2018-06-04 10:16:40 -07:00